Gymnastic Groundwork Part 3 of 6: Teaching Lateral Movements.
This video is all about teaching lateral movements using clicker training.
Lateral exercises where your horse is going sideways as well as forwards are really useful to build your horse’s suppleness, strength and straightness, which is why they’ve been used for thousands of years in both in-hand training and ridden work! But, how do we teach them using positive reinforcement?
By training a combination of cues through the isolations (part 2), such as lateral flexions, shoulders over and quarters-over, we can combine these with our leading work. This makes it a clear and simple process for you and your horse.
In this video, you’ll see how to introduce lateral work from the ground in exercises such as leg-yield and shoulder-in and you’ll see Rowan learning haunches-in.
This is all trained softly with relaxation as a priority and I use a marker (clicker training) and rewards to motivate and reinforce my horse.

Explain the prop please . What have you trained her to do- is the ball where you want her head? I was thinking of tapping the horse with a ball at the end of a whip but that’s not what you’re doing
@ConnectionTraining
@ConnectionTraining Ай бұрын
Its a hand held target used in positive reinforcement training. Targeting is one of the most useful behaviours you can train your horse for leading, loading, de-spooking, lunging, groundwork and riding etc. However before this you would need to teach target training so that your horse understands the task and is comfortable touching a target with their nose.
